QUESTION:

Testing for Rank Correlation. In Exercises 7–12, use the rank correlation coefficient to test for a correlation between the two variables. Use a significance level of \(\alpha=0.05\).

Judges of Marching Bands Two judges ranked seven bands in the Texas state finals competition of marching bands (Coppell, Keller, Grapevine, Dickinson, Poteet, Fossil Ridge, Heritage), and their rankings are listed below (based on data from the University Interscholastic League). Test for a correlation between the two judges. Do the judges appear to rank about the same or are they very different?
